To celebrate the launch of the new iPhone 14, Verizon is bringing about a new plan geared toward iPhone users, although Android users can get in on it, too.<\/p>\n
Verizon has introduced (opens in new tab)<\/span> its new One Unlimited plan for iPhone, which bundles Apple Music, Apple TV+, Apple Arcade, and iCloud+. The phone service provider says that the new plan is valued at $480 a year and is shareable with your entire family. Verizon says that this plan is open to new and existing customers, regardless of whether you’re sporting the latest iPhone 14 or one of the best Android phones.<\/p>\n
